Finance Review Summary — Heads of Department, Tellwick Group

The proposed expansion into the Maravia region was assessed against three funding scenarios. Capital requirements fall within the approved envelope, though currency hedging costs exceed initial estimates by 6%. Local hiring and lease commitments remain contingent on regulatory clearance expected next quarter. Department heads should hold related budget lines open. The commercial targets underpinning this expansion appear in the confidential note below.

internal memo for hahaf-fahip: Project Silwyn slips by two quarters because of the staffing delay.

If Flagpole rollouts start misbehaving at 3 a.m., your first stop is the /rollouts/status endpoint — it tells you which cohorts are stuck mid-ramp. You can force a rollback with POST /rollouts/{id}/halt, which takes effect within a minute. All control-plane calls hit the Flagpole admin API, and they'll need the key below.

gateway credential: kto23_LX9A4ys6i4nzHtpOLNLodKK

# Currency conversion notes — Trovelane billing
# New folks: all FX math uses integer minor units. Never convert with
# floats; the Q3 rounding drift came from a float path in the refund job.
# Use the ratefix helper, which banker-rounds once at display time only.
# Mid-market rates come from the Corvessa feed, which needs its access
# credential defined in this file. The next line sets it:

env line for yahip-tafog: RELAY_SECRET3=4ca

## Step 4: Switch to the New Deduplicator

Heads up — Pagewren's dedup window is now per-service, not global, so duplicate pages should drop noticeably. Flip the old suppressor off before enabling the new one, or alerts double up. Once it's running, point the new instance at the following configuration values.

deployment values, yadup-kadug:
[sorys]
port = 5672
team = noveth
host = sorys.orvexcorp.example
region = south-4
access_code = ac_deddc1
timeout_ms = 1500